William Rankine, a designer and physicist, developed a different to Coulomb's earth pressure theory. Albert Atterberg created the clay consistency indices that are still utilized today for soil category. In 1885, Osborne Reynolds recognized that shearing causes volumetric expansion of thick materials and tightening of loose granular products. Modern geotechnical design is stated to have begun in 1925 with the publication of Erdbaumechanik by Karl von Terzaghi, a mechanical engineer and geologist.

Terzaghi also established the structure for concepts of birthing capacity of structures, and the concept for forecast of the price of negotiation of clay layers because of consolidation. After that, Maurice Biot fully developed the three-dimensional soil debt consolidation concept, prolonging the one-dimensional design previously developed by Terzaghi to much more general theories and presenting the collection of standard formulas of Poroelasticity.

Geotechnical designers examine and identify the properties of subsurface problems and products. They likewise develop corresponding earthworks and retaining structures, passages, and structure foundations, and might oversee and assess websites, which might better include site tracking along with the threat analysis and mitigation of all-natural hazards. Geotechnical designers and design rock hounds perform geotechnical investigations to obtain information on the physical properties of dirt and rock hidden and beside a site to design earthworks and foundations for suggested frameworks and for the repair work of distress to earthworks and structures triggered by subsurface problems.

Geologic mapping and interpretation of geomorphology are generally finished in appointment with a geologist or design rock hound. Subsurface exploration typically entails in-situ testing (for instance, the typical infiltration test and cone penetration examination). The digging of test pits and trenching (especially for locating mistakes and slide planes) might additionally be made use of to discover dirt problems at deepness. Still, they are occasionally utilized to enable a geologist or engineer to be reduced right into the borehole for straight visual and hand-operated exam of the dirt and rock stratigraphy. Different dirt samplers exist to satisfy the demands of various design jobs. The conventional infiltration test, which utilizes a thick-walled split spoon sampler, is one of the most common means to gather disrupted examples.

Geotechnical engineers can evaluate and enhance slope stability making use of engineering techniques. A previously steady incline may be originally affected by numerous aspects, making it unstable. Geotechnical designers can create and carry out engineered slopes to increase stability - Specialized Geotechnical Engineering Solutions.

Commonly, the user interface's precise geometry is unknown, and a simplified user interface geometry is thought. Limited slopes call for three-dimensional models to be examined, so most slopes are evaluated assuming that they are infinitely broad and can be represented by two-dimensional versions.

The empirical technique may be explained as follows: General expedition sufficient to develop the rough nature, pattern, and buildings of deposits. Assessment of one of the most potential problems and the most unfavorable imaginable variances. Producing the style based on a working theory of behavior expected under the most possible problems. Option of amounts to be observed as construction earnings and calculating their prepared for values based upon the working theory under one of the most unfavorable conditions.

Measurement of amounts and evaluation of actual conditions. It is improper for jobs whose design can not be changed during building.
